Lead Data Engineer - Python/ AWS. Asset Management. £120,000 -£140,000+ Discretionary Bonus + Benefits. Hybrid 2 Days a week in Central London office.

My client is a US$5bn+ alternative asset manager operating across seven global offices: New York, BVI, London, Switzerland, Dubai, Singapore, and Hong Kong.

The firm serves institutional investors and high-net-worth clients through a range of alternative investment strategies.

My clients technology strategy is built around a proprietary, cloud-native platform.

The firm's technology function is structured as a lean, high-output engineering team comprising three developers led by the firm's COO.

This structure means every engineer has significant ownership, direct impact on the platform, and close visibility to senior leadership and business stakeholders.

The Role

They are looking for a Data Engineer to join their small engineering team and help evolve their data platform alongside two other engineers.

This is not a narrowly defined \"build what you're told\" role.

They need someone who can identify business problems, map data architecture, and help drive solutions end-to-end.

You'll work directly with operations, research, and investment teams to understand what data they need, where bottlenecks exist, why data is delayed or missing, and how to improve the flow of data across the business.

This role is fundamentally data-engineering focused.

They are looking for someone with strong data engineering fundamentals who is comfortable owning production systems, improving reliability and freshness, and working across team boundaries when needed.

The role spans both operating existing production pipelines and building new capabilities, with priorities shifting based on business needs.

You should be comfortable working in a small team with high autonomy, wearing multiple hats, and moving between technical investigation, stakeholder conversations, and hands‑on delivery.

  • What You’ll Do
  • Solve business problems with data – work with ops, research, and investment teams to identify pain points and deliver practical solutions, not just tickets
  • Improve the data platform end-to-end – ingestion, transformation, storage, serving, observability, and reliability
  • Optimise data freshness and reliability – reduce latency, eliminate stale data, and improve alerting so failures are not silent
  • Map and improve data architecture – identify inefficiencies, reduce unnecessary handoffs, and streamline how data flows from vendors to consumers
  • Operate and maintain production data pipelines ingesting from financial data vendors
  • Build and extend new vendor integrations, data products, and pipeline features
  • Manage infrastructure on AWS using Terraform
  • Build AI capabilities including RAG pipelines and OCR-based document extraction to unlock unstructured data sources
  • Collaborate with the wider engineering team, including on systems that interact with our client-facing Next JS application
  • Plan and prioritise work in collaboration with technical and non‑technical stakeholders
  • Tools & Technologies
  • Python – primary language for ETL, API clients, data validation, and pipeline development
  • SQL – analytical and transactional queries, transformations, and data investigation
  • AWS – cloud infrastructure and managed services
  • Terraform – infrastructure‑as‑code
  • Mongo DB – document storage
  • Monitoring / observability tools – for alerting, debugging, and production support
  • Git Hub Actions – CI/CD pipelines
  • Linear – project planning and task management
  • Claude Code, Cursor, Codex – AI engineering tools used in daily workflow
  • Next JS / Type Script – exposure helpful, but this is not a full‑stack role
